Output 96d87c67909be862c36ee88ae45d4ca877d66f86766d5ecb13bc408026204820:0

value
6458290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 578aae8a8632cb34e27b544075e52258d4c6daf2 OP_EQUALVERIFY OP_CHECKSIG
address
18ysvUF9FydaB8haXoz8rCYLEZrC1Qi4BU
transaction
96d87c67909be862c36ee88ae45d4ca877d66f86766d5ecb13bc408026204820
spent
true